New Study Shows BofA purchase of LaSalle Bank Likely to Cost More Than 10,500 Chicago Jobs

$780 Million Expected to Vanish from Area Economy, Neighborhoods: 

CHICAGO – More than 10,500 Chicago jobs are expected to disappear in just two years if Bank of America follows through with promised cuts of 50% of LaSalle Bank’s costs, shows a new study released today conducted by Anderson Economic Group. The report, entitled “Economic and Fiscal Impact of LaSalle Bank Acquisition,” predicts job losses from an impending merger of locally-based LaSalle Bank with America’s largest bank would drain more than $780 million from Chicago’s economy during the same time period. More than 6,000 jobs alone will likely be lost from companies other than LaSalle due to a spillover effect to other area businesses resulting from the merger.
